Your boss may demand a tighter rein on budgets but would they be prepared to forsake comfort if it mean saving a few dollars? There’s cost cutting and then there’s cost cutting, and bizarrely Ryanair’s standing room only flights appear to have got the thumbs up from customers. When questioned, 66 per cent of 120,000 respondents said they’d stand on a short haul flight if it meant a free ticket, while 42 per cent said they’d agree to pay a fee for the privilege of standing up for a flight. We’d imagine though that business users would be less enthusiastic – after all who really feels rested and ready for a big meeting if you’ve had to stand up for the duration of your flight?
